Navigating the Use of CBD Oil and Sleep Aid Medications

Navigating the use of CBD oil and sleep aid medications has become increasingly important as individuals seek alternative solutions for improving their sleep quality. When considering the use of CBD oil alongside sleep aid medications, it's crucial to be aware of dosing differences and potential interactions. CBD oil may affect the metabolism of certain medications, leading to either increased or decreased blood levels of the medications. This emphasizes the importance of consulting with a healthcare professional before combining CBD oil with sleep aids.

Furthermore, understanding the potential side effects of both CBD oil and sleep aid medications is essential. While CBD is generally well-tolerated, it can cause side effects such as nausea, fatigue, and irritability, especially when taken in high doses. On the other hand, sleep aid medications can also have side effects, including dizziness, drowsiness, and cognitive impairment. Combining these substances may exacerbate these side effects, impacting overall well-being and daily functioning.

What Are the Differences in Tolerance and Dependency Between CBD Oil and Pharmaceutical Sleep Aids?

When it comes to tolerance differences and dependency comparison between CBD oil and pharmaceutical sleep aids, it's important to note that CBD is generally considered to have a lower risk of tolerance and dependency compared to traditional pharmaceuticals.

This is due to the different ways in which CBD interacts with the body's endocannabinoid system compared to the mechanisms of action of pharmaceutical sleep aids. These differences can play a significant role in how tolerance and dependency develop.
